基于fpga的qpsk调制
时间: 2023-07-28 08:02:52 浏览: 141
基于FPGA的QPSK调制是一种利用现场可编程门阵列(FPGA)实现的四相移键控(QPSK)信号调制技术。FPGA是一种可编程逻辑器件,可以通过编程实现各种数字电路和信号处理功能。
QPSK调制是一种数字调制技术,将两个独立的数据比特组合成一个复合的符号,并映射到特定的相位点上。相比较二进制调制,QPSK调制可以传输两倍的数据率。基于FPGA的QPSK调制系统可以实现高效的信号处理和可靠的通信。
在基于FPGA的QPSK调制系统中,首先需要进行数据的生成和调制。数据可以通过FPGA内部的逻辑运算单元生成或外部输入。然后,通过相位偏移键控器(PSK)模块将数据映射到相应的相位点上。FPGA的高度可编程性可以实现不同的相位映射方式,如Grey码映射和传统QPSK映射等。
接下来是将调制后的信号进行滤波和选择性放大。FPGA可以实现数字滤波器的功能,用于去除调制后信号中的噪声和干扰,并对信号进行频率选择性放大。这样可以提高信号质量和抗干扰能力。
最后,通过FPGA上的数字到模拟转换器(DAC)将数字信号转换为模拟信号,并通过发射天线发送到接收端。接收端使用QPSK解调器将接收到的信号转换为数字信号,并通过FPGA进行解调和恢复原始数据。
基于FPGA的QPSK调制技术具有灵活性、可编程性和高性能的优势。它可以根据不同的应用需求进行灵活的配置和优化,适用于无线通信、卫星通信、无线电传输等领域。
相关问题
基于fpga的qpsk调制解调
QPSK调制解调是一种数字通信调制方式,可以使用FPGA实现。下面简单介绍一下QPSK调制解调的实现方法。
在QPSK调制中,原始数据被分成两个比特一组,每组比特控制正交载波的相位和幅度。在解调端,通过对接收信号进行相位和幅度检测,将其解调成原始数据。
在FPGA中实现QPSK调制解调,可以采用数模转换器将数字信号转换为模拟信号,然后通过正交混频器将两个模拟信号调制到两个正交载波上,最后通过低通滤波器滤去高频成分,得到QPSK调制信号。
在解调端,可以采用正交解调器将接收到的信号分别与两个正交载波相乘,得到两个正交信号的相位和幅度信息,然后再通过比特同步器将两个比特一组的数据解调出来。
需要注意的是,在FPGA实现QPSK调制解调时,需要考虑到时钟同步、频率漂移、相位偏移等问题,可以采用PLL、FIR滤波器等技术解决。
fpga qpsk调制解调 csdn
FPGA(现场可编程门阵列)是一种集成电路(IC)技术,它可以在设计完成后再进行编程和重构,具有灵活性和可重用性,被广泛应用于数字信号处理、图像处理、通信和自动化等领域。
QPSK(Quadrature Phase Shift Keying)调制是一种数字调制技术,它可以将二进制数字转换成符号,并将其转换为相位和幅度信息来传输数据。QPSK调制技术被广泛应用于卫星通信、移动通信和无线局域网等领域。
FPGA可以实现QPSK调制解调技术,具有快速响应、低功耗和高可靠性等优点。在FPGA中,实现QPSK调制解调需要编写相应的Verilog HDL代码,包括生成符号序列、QPSK调制、信号解调和误码率计算等模块。
CSDN(China Software Development Network)是中国领先的技术社区和在线教育平台,为广大开发者提供技术交流、学习和职业发展等服务。在CSDN上,可以找到许多与FPGA和QPSK调制解调相关的教程和资源,帮助开发者提高技能和解决技术难题。